By REPUBLICA

KATHMANDU, May 21: The Commission for the Investigation of Abuse of Authority (CIAA) on Wednesday raided the Immigration Office at Tribhuvan International Airport (TIA) and seized several documents and electronic devices as part of an ongoing investigation into alleged bribery.


The anti-graft body took the step following complaints that immigration officials had been illegally collecting large sums of money from workers traveling abroad. Acting on the information, the CIAA deployed a team on Wednesday to confiscate relevant materials and initiate further investigation.

According to sources, the raid was prompted by increasing complaints about a bribery network operating within the office. The CIAA team seized documents and devices believed to be linked to the alleged irregularities, including those related to the office head.


Just a day before the raid, the Ministry of Home Affairs had transferred the then chief of the Immigration Office, Tirtha Raj Bhattarai, and appointed Under Secretary Bishnu Prasad Koirala, who previously served as the Chief District Officer of Panchthar, as his replacement.


The CIAA has also taken Bhattarai into custody for questioning in connection with the case.
